Slaying a UI Antipattern in Fantasyland
Stefan Oestreicher

That is something actually I’ve been thinking about recently. Problem of having `loading`property is that you are mixing data and state, which is not good thing by itself.

But my thinking is that for this *exact* use case (async operation with result/error) we already have a representation and it is even a part of the language itself — promise.

